Sharks skipper Paul Gallen will make his fourth appearance in the NRL All Stars clash when he takes to the field for the World All Stars on February 13.

Named along side fellow NRL stars such as Cameron Smith, Roger Tuivasa-Sheck and Sam Burgess, Gallen is excited by the prospect of lining up against a quality opposition.

Fellow Sharks teammates Ben Barba, Andrew Fifita and Wade Graham have been named in the Indigenous All Stars side which is also brimming with talent.

"They're both outstanding sides. I'd say 80% of those players would make most rep teams around the world so there's certainly some real high-quality players there," said Gallen.

With the Sharks not drawn to play the Broncos in Brisbane in 2016, the All Stars match is a great chance for Cronulla fans North of the NSW border to see their heroes in action.
